We’ve been hearing about electronic scoring for years. Nobody has been able to do it successfully. Shotgunworld.com has thread after thread on why it can’t work. YSR-Racer has been telling us for years why it will.
Had it yesterday on the Promatic Preliminary. Was flawless. Every trapper understood it. Very minor hiccups in the first rotation but I heard of nothing else but one low battery. No shuffling papers, standing to see who is picking them up, no master sheet. Get into the stand, who is up first? Shoot, verify your score and that’s it.
Casey and her team at ScoreChaser pulled this off when there were tons of doubters. I feel it saved at least a minute and a half at every station on a 15 station course.
I would say the only negative is not having your physical scorecard to see how or where you were dropping targets was it first pairs or was it in the middle or last bird to see patterns.
